Online Key-by-VIN Suppliers
Online key-by VIN suppliers can be a good alternative for those who are unable to get to a locksmith or dealer. These companies use the VIN number to make a replacement key that's the original from the factory. They charge less than a locksmith or dealer but you'll require an automotive technician connect the key to your car.
Most cars from 1990 and upwards come with a transponder chip within the key that must be programmed to the vehicle in order to function. This is why it's crucial to use a car key code instead of the VIN when requesting keys from a key-by-VIN provider online. If you choose to use the VIN, it's likely that the key won't function if your ignition has ever been replaced or the door locks have been changed.
It's also important to note that even though online key-by-VIN suppliers can cut your keys, they can't provide you with a key that's programmed to your car. This task will still require an auto technician, so make sure you add this cost into your budget.
Dealers, locksmiths and online key-by-VIN suppliers are the most reliable in terms of accuracy. They all cut their keys by code, which is what gives you the genuine OEM cut key. In contrast, big box stores only cut their keys with an automatic machine that can be less precise over time and may result in a key that does not work properly.
